0 reports about 8416569033The number was first reported 19th Jun, 2025
Received a phone call from 8416569033? Report here
File a report about 8416569033 |
Phone Number Variations: 8416569033, 08416-569033, 918416569033, 008416569033, 1918416569033, +1918416569033